An equation is shown. 8 - 2(x + 10) = 4x - 6 What is the value of x?
A. -33
B. -8
C. -1
D. 4

A farmer is plowing her fields. She has already plowed 12 acres. The farmer continues to plow at a constant rate so that she will have plowed a total of 36 acres after 4 hours. Which equation could the farmer use to find the number of acres, y, she will have plowed after x hours?
y = 6x + 12
y = 9x + 12
y = 12x + 6
y = 12x + 9
